Jessica Zrinski was a ray of sunshine with a big heart who loved singing, dancing and spending time with her family, until her life was tragically cut short.
One of the last-known sightings of Jessica was at 10.10pm on November 28, 2022, when security footage captured her getting into a blue Holden Commodore at Greenfield Tavern, in Sydney’s west.
She had just left her grandmother’s house.
About 15 minutes later, footage from a petrol station in Horsley Park showed Jessica sitting in the passenger seat of the same car with a man in a grey t-shirt.
He refuelled, before jumping back in the driver’s side with two bottles of Coke and taking off.
The following day, on November 29, the same car was captured pulling into a petrol station at Mount Victoria, in the Blue Mountains, about 90km west of Horsley Park. There was damage on the vehicle, and a tree branch jammed in the door.
Jessica could not be seen in the footage.
The 30-year-old was often uncontactable for days at a time, so her family didn’t report her missing until December 3 – but by then, it was too late. She was never seen again.
Jessica’s aunt and uncle, Robyn and Vlad Zrinski, have partnered with the team behind the award-winning podcast, Dear Rachelle, for a new multimedia investigation called Left in the Cold. It explores Jessica’s missing persons case, which has lay stagnant for almost three years.
